I agree with you. I think the origin of the myth lays in the Valachi Hearing Genovese chart where Carmine Persico is listed as a soldier, and a member of Mike Miranda´s crew. Not knowing that this was an error, people assumed (although the picture on the chart clearly depicts Persico Jr) that this was his father.

Accountant or not, Persico Sr was a wife beater. (From Brooklyn Daily Eagle, June 28, 1930):

Image


Can´t find any article that ties Persico Sr to organized crime.
